- Parking near the Old Town can be tight and expensive. Rentals with GPS navigation support help locate affordable, safe spots. Street parking requires permits, but many car services include a fixed daily rate that covers this.
- Be aware of road rules: speed limits, pedestrian zones, and parking restrictions apply in historic districts.
- Check tire condition, insurance coverage, and GPS capabilities before departure.
- Confirm pickup and drop-off zones to avoid unnecessary fees. Most users find it cost-effective when comparing daily rates, fuel efficiency, and avoided parking fees. With many deals under $50 per day and flexible 24- to 72-hour plans, the investment shrinks—especially when shared between travelers or paired with weekend planning.
